Craig Seeman
July 9, 2011 at 3:54 pm[Ben Scott] “the send to compressor seems to be similar to qtref”
Sorry but it’s not. QTRef files were usable in other programs on the same computer whether it was other encoders like Telestream Episode or Sorenson Squeeze or even other Apple Apps like Motion which now as no Round Trip support. Ref files could be played in QT as well without having to open FCP. While people complain about major missing features, for me it’s the scores of little things missing that are dragging down FCPX.
